Your Transport Options for Container Moving in Ontario

The right method for your container move depends on your site, your distance, and your timeline. Understanding what is available helps you get a container transport quote Ontario that reflects your actual requirements rather than a generic estimate.

Tilt Deck and Roll-Off Delivery

For most local and regional moves, a tilt deck or roll-off truck is the standard method. The truck backs in, tilts or rolls the container off its bed, and places it on your site without additional lifting equipment.

This covers the majority of shipping container moving Toronto, shipping container moving Mississauga, and GTA container transport requests across the region.

Your site needs roughly 100 feet of clear approach and a reasonably level surface for this method to work cleanly.

Key Points

  • Standard method for most Ontario container transport and GTA moves

  • Fastest and most cost-effective option for sites with clear vehicle access

  • Requires 100 feet of clear approach and adequate overhead clearance

  • Available for both 20ft container moving service and 40ft container delivery

Crane and Hiab Offload

When your site cannot accommodate a full truck approach, crane or hiab offload lifts the container into position regardless of access restrictions.

This is the right call for tight urban yards, sites behind existing structures, and locations with overhead obstructions.

Crane offload costs more than tilt deck delivery but expands your placement options significantly in dense urban environments.

Intermodal Container Transport for Long-Distance Moves

For long distance container moving Canada, intermodal container transport combines road and rail to move containers efficiently over large distances.

Rail reduces per-kilometre cost significantly on moves exceeding 500 kilometres, making it the most affordable option for shipping container moving Canada between provinces.

What Drives Your Shipping Container Moving Cost

Shipping container moving prices vary based on several factors. Knowing what affects your quote helps you provide the right information upfront and avoid surprises on your final invoice.

Container Size

A 20ft container moving service quote is lower than a 40ft equivalent on the same route.

The shorter unit is lighter, easier to maneuver on site, and compatible with a wider range of equipment.

A 40ft container moving cost increases further when the unit is loaded, because gross weight determines whether standard or heavy equipment hauling containers resources are needed.

Distance and Route

Local GTA moves including shipping container moving Toronto and shipping container moving Mississauga are typically priced on a flat or hourly rate.

Ontario container transport across longer provincial distances moves to a per-kilometre pricing model.

For long distance container moving Canada, intermodal routing reduces cost substantially compared to full road transport.

Site Conditions

Your site is one of the biggest cost variables.

A clear, level drop on a commercial lot is the most affordable scenario.

Sites requiring crane offload, ground preparation, access permits, or traffic management add to the total.

Accurate site information at the quote stage ensures your shipping container moving service cost reflects reality.

Empty vs Loaded

Empty container moves are faster to execute and less expensive than loaded moves.

Loaded containers require:

  • Payload documentation

  • Weight verification

  • Load securing confirmation before transport

If you can move the container empty, your shipping container moving prices will reflect that difference.

Preparing Your Site for Safe Container Delivery

Site preparation is where container moves succeed or fail.

When your site is not ready, deliveries get delayed, re-delivery charges apply, and improvised solutions add risk.

Getting this right before the truck arrives saves time and money.

Ground and Load Bearing

A loaded 40ft container places significant point load on its four corner castings.

Place timber sleepers or precast concrete blocks under each corner before your container arrives.

Ontario winters add another factor. Frost movement can shift an unsupported container out of level over a single season.

Preparation Checklist

  • Use timber sleepers or concrete pads under all four corner castings

  • Compact soft or recently disturbed ground before placement

  • Avoid slopes greater than 3 degrees without leveling preparation first

Access and Approach

Confirm you have:

  • At least 100 feet of clear approach for tilt deck delivery

  • Adequate overhead clearance along the full approach

  • Gate widths that accommodate a full-length transport truck

Identify these constraints at the quote stage, not on delivery day.

Access Requirements

  • Minimum 100 feet of clear straight approach for tilt deck delivery

  • Overhead clearance of at least 5 metres along the full vehicle approach

  • Check gate widths and turning radius before confirming delivery method

Municipal Permits

Some Ontario municipalities require permits for containers placed on properties for extended periods.

Urban properties in Toronto, Mississauga, and across the GTA are most likely to have bylaw requirements.

Confirm your local requirements before your container arrives.
